[MacOS 26 Tahoe] High GPU usage by WindowServer on Intel-based MacBook Pro (2019, 16-inch) when running VSCode #267065

  • VS Code Version: 1.104.0 (Universal)
  • OS Version: macOS 26 (Tahoe)
  • Device: MacBook Pro 16-inch, 2019 (Intel chip)
  • GPU: AMD Radeon Pro AMD Radeon Pro 5300M

Steps to Reproduce:

  1. Open VSCode on Intel-based MacBook Pro (2019).
  2. Observe system performance via Activity Monitor.
  3. Notice that the WindowServer process shows unusually high GPU usage (around 90%).

Expected Behavior:
VSCode should run smoothly without causing excessive GPU usage on Intel-based MacBooks.

Actual Behavior:

  • WindowServer process consistently shows high GPU usage (up to ~90%) when VSCode is running.
  • System performance becomes noticeably slower.
  • This issue is not obviously observed on Apple Silicon (M-series) devices.
